{"id":475927,"date":"2023-08-09T07:24:43","date_gmt":"2023-08-09T07:24:43","guid":{"rendered":""},"modified":"2023-09-05T11:11:38","modified_gmt":"2023-09-05T11:11:38","slug":"asynchronous-transmission","status":"publish","type":"wiki","link":"https:\/\/oneproxy.pro\/it\/wiki\/asynchronous-transmission\/","title":{"rendered":"Trasmissione asincrona"},"content":{"rendered":"<p>La trasmissione asincrona \u00e8 un metodo di comunicazione ampiamente utilizzato nelle reti informatiche e nelle telecomunicazioni, consentendo la trasmissione di dati tra dispositivi senza la necessit\u00e0 di orologi sincronizzati. A differenza della trasmissione sincrona, in cui i dati vengono inviati a intervalli di tempo fissi, la trasmissione asincrona invia i dati come singoli caratteri o frame con bit di inizio e fine, consentendo uno scambio efficiente di dati tra dispositivi che operano a velocit\u00e0 diverse.<\/p>\n<h2>La storia dell&#039;origine della trasmissione asincrona e la sua prima menzione<\/h2>\n<p>Il concetto di trasmissione asincrona pu\u00f2 essere fatto risalire agli albori della telegrafia. A met\u00e0 del XIX secolo, i primi sistemi telegrafici elettrici utilizzavano il codice Morse per trasmettere informazioni in modo asincrono. La trasmissione si basava sull&#039;immissione manuale dei segnali da parte dell&#039;operatore, rendendola intrinsecamente asincrona. Questo metodo segn\u00f2 l&#039;inizio della comunicazione asincrona, che successivamente si evolse con i progressi tecnologici.<\/p>\n<h2>Informazioni dettagliate sulla trasmissione asincrona<\/h2>\n<p>La trasmissione asincrona si basa su un principio semplice ma efficace. Ogni frame di dati inviato contiene un bit di inizio, i bit di dati stessi, un bit di parit\u00e0 opzionale per il controllo degli errori e uno o pi\u00f9 bit di stop. Il bit di inizio indica l&#039;inizio di un frame, mentre i bit di stop indicano la fine. Questa struttura consente alla trasmissione asincrona di essere pi\u00f9 flessibile e meno dipendente da tempistiche rigorose, rendendola adatta ad un&#039;ampia gamma di applicazioni.<\/p>\n<h2>La struttura interna della trasmissione asincrona e come funziona<\/h2>\n<p>Per comprendere la struttura interna della trasmissione asincrona, analizziamo il processo passo dopo passo:<\/p>\n<ol>\n<li>\n<p>Composizione del frame di dati: come accennato in precedenza, ciascun frame di dati comprende un bit di inizio, bit di dati, un bit di parit\u00e0 (opzionale) e uno o pi\u00f9 bit di stop.<\/p>\n<\/li>\n<li>\n<p>Invio di dati: il dispositivo trasmittente inizia inviando il bit di avvio, seguito dai bit di dati, dal bit di parit\u00e0 opzionale e infine dai bit di stop. Il dispositivo mittente non attende la conferma da parte del destinatario, rendendolo asincrono.<\/p>\n<\/li>\n<li>\n<p>Ricezione dati: il dispositivo ricevente monitora la linea di trasmissione per i bit di avvio. Quando viene rilevato un bit di inizio, inizia a leggere di conseguenza i bit di dati, il bit di parit\u00e0 e i bit di stop.<\/p>\n<\/li>\n<li>\n<p>Natura asincrona: la trasmissione asincrona consente al mittente e al destinatario di operare in modo indipendente senza la necessit\u00e0 di un segnale di clock condiviso. Questa indipendenza lo rende adatto a vari scenari di comunicazione, soprattutto quando i dispositivi hanno velocit\u00e0 di clock diverse o quando trasmettono su canali rumorosi.<\/p>\n<\/li>\n<\/ol>\n<h2>Analisi delle caratteristiche principali della trasmissione asincrona<\/h2>\n<p>La trasmissione asincrona possiede diverse caratteristiche chiave che la rendono preziosa nei sistemi di comunicazione:<\/p>\n<ol>\n<li>\n<p>Flessibilit\u00e0: la trasmissione asincrona non richiede una sincronizzazione rigorosa tra mittente e destinatario, consentendo ai dispositivi di funzionare a velocit\u00e0 diverse senza causare problemi di comunicazione.<\/p>\n<\/li>\n<li>\n<p>Rilevamento degli errori: il bit di parit\u00e0 opzionale nel frame di dati consente il rilevamento degli errori di base, fornendo un meccanismo semplice per verificare l&#039;integrit\u00e0 dei dati.<\/p>\n<\/li>\n<li>\n<p>Efficienza: la struttura dei bit start-stop consente alla trasmissione asincrona di essere efficiente, poich\u00e9 riduce al minimo il sovraccarico e garantisce l&#039;integrit\u00e0 dei dati con una ridondanza minima.<\/p>\n<\/li>\n<li>\n<p>Tolleranza al rumore: la trasmissione asincrona pu\u00f2 gestire i canali di comunicazione rumorosi in modo pi\u00f9 efficace rispetto ai metodi sincroni, poich\u00e9 non si basa su tempi precisi.<\/p>\n<\/li>\n<\/ol>\n<h2>Tipi di trasmissione asincrona<\/h2>\n<p>La trasmissione asincrona pu\u00f2 essere classificata in due tipi principali in base al numero di bit di stop utilizzati:<\/p>\n<table>\n<thead>\n<tr>\n<th>Tipi<\/th>\n<th>Descrizione<\/th>\n<\/tr>\n<\/thead>\n<tbody>\n<tr>\n<td>1 bit di arresto<\/td>\n<td>Il tipo pi\u00f9 comune, in cui un singolo bit di stop segue i bit di dati.<\/td>\n<\/tr>\n<tr>\n<td>2 bit di arresto<\/td>\n<td>Un tipo meno comune, in cui due bit di stop seguono i bit di dati.<\/td>\n<\/tr>\n<\/tbody>\n<\/table>\n<h2>Modi per utilizzare la trasmissione asincrona, problemi e relative soluzioni<\/h2>\n<p>La trasmissione asincrona trova applicazioni in diversi ambiti, tra cui:<\/p>\n<ol>\n<li>\n<p>Comunicazione seriale: \u00e8 comunemente utilizzata nella comunicazione seriale tra computer e dispositivi periferici come tastiere, mouse e stampanti.<\/p>\n<\/li>\n<li>\n<p>Modem: la trasmissione asincrona \u00e8 il fondamento della comunicazione modem, facilitando lo scambio di dati tra computer tramite linee telefoniche.<\/p>\n<\/li>\n<li>\n<p>Dispositivi IoT: molti dispositivi Internet of Things (IoT) utilizzano la trasmissione asincrona per un trasferimento dati efficiente e un risparmio energetico.<\/p>\n<\/li>\n<\/ol>\n<p>Nonostante i suoi vantaggi, la trasmissione asincrona deve affrontare anche delle sfide, come ad esempio:<\/p>\n<ol>\n<li>\n<p>Velocit\u00e0 dati limitata: la trasmissione asincrona potrebbe non essere adatta per il trasferimento dati ad alta velocit\u00e0 a causa del sovraccarico introdotto dai bit di avvio e di arresto.<\/p>\n<\/li>\n<li>\n<p>Problemi di sincronizzazione: la comunicazione asincrona pu\u00f2 soffrire di problemi di sincronizzazione quando i dispositivi funzionano a velocit\u00e0 notevolmente diverse.<\/p>\n<\/li>\n<\/ol>\n<p>Per affrontare queste sfide, vengono utilizzate tecniche come il controllo del flusso e i protocolli di correzione degli errori per ottimizzare la comunicazione asincrona.<\/p>\n<h2>Caratteristiche principali e confronti con termini simili<\/h2>\n<p>Ecco un confronto tra la trasmissione asincrona e metodi di comunicazione simili:<\/p>\n<table>\n<thead>\n<tr>\n<th>Caratteristica<\/th>\n<th>Trasmissione asincrona<\/th>\n<th>Trasmissione sincrona<\/th>\n<\/tr>\n<\/thead>\n<tbody>\n<tr>\n<td>Tempistica<\/td>\n<td>Non c&#039;\u00e8 bisogno di orologi sincronizzati.<\/td>\n<td>Richiede orologi sincronizzati.<\/td>\n<\/tr>\n<tr>\n<td>In testa<\/td>\n<td>Basso sovraccarico grazie ai bit start-stop.<\/td>\n<td>Overhead pi\u00f9 elevato a causa della tempistica costante.<\/td>\n<\/tr>\n<tr>\n<td>Compatibilit\u00e0 di velocit\u00e0<\/td>\n<td>Compatibile con diverse velocit\u00e0 del dispositivo.<\/td>\n<td>Richiede che i dispositivi abbiano velocit\u00e0 simili.<\/td>\n<\/tr>\n<tr>\n<td>Controllo degli errori<\/td>\n<td>Controllo degli errori di base utilizzando il bit di parit\u00e0.<\/td>\n<td>Potrebbe richiedere protocolli avanzati di controllo degli errori.<\/td>\n<\/tr>\n<\/tbody>\n<\/table>\n<h2>Prospettive e tecnologie future legate alla trasmissione asincrona<\/h2>\n<p>\u00c8 probabile che in futuro la trasmissione asincrona continui a svolgere un ruolo significativo nei sistemi di comunicazione. Con l\u2019avanzare della tecnologia, possiamo aspettarci miglioramenti nelle tecniche di rilevamento e correzione degli errori, migliorando ulteriormente l\u2019affidabilit\u00e0 e l\u2019efficienza della comunicazione asincrona.<\/p>\n<h2>Come \u00e8 possibile utilizzare o associare i server proxy alla trasmissione asincrona<\/h2>\n<p>I server proxy fungono da intermediari tra client e server, facilitando varie attivit\u00e0 di comunicazione. Sebbene non siano direttamente legati alla trasmissione asincrona, i server proxy possono migliorare il processo di comunicazione complessivo ottimizzando lo scambio di dati, gestendo la memorizzazione nella cache e fornendo un ulteriore livello di sicurezza.<\/p>\n<h2>Link correlati<\/h2>\n<p>Per ulteriori informazioni sulla trasmissione asincrona, \u00e8 possibile esplorare le seguenti risorse:<\/p>\n<ol>\n<li><a href=\"https:\/\/en.wikipedia.org\/wiki\/Asynchronous_serial_communication\" target=\"_new\" rel=\"noopener nofollow\">Wikipedia \u2013 Comunicazione seriale asincrona<\/a><\/li>\n<li><a href=\"https:\/\/www.tutorialspoint.com\/data_communication_computer_network\/asynchronous_transmission.htm\" target=\"_new\" rel=\"noopener nofollow\">Tutorialspoint \u2013 Trasmissione asincrona<\/a><\/li>\n<li><a href=\"https:\/\/www.electronics-tutorials.ws\/communication\/asynchronous-synchronous.html\" target=\"_new\" rel=\"noopener nofollow\">Tutorial elettronici \u2013 Trasmissione asincrona e sincrona<\/a><\/li>\n<\/ol>\n<p>In conclusione, la trasmissione asincrona \u00e8 un metodo di comunicazione fondamentale che ha una ricca storia e continua ad essere vitale nei moderni sistemi di comunicazione. La sua flessibilit\u00e0, efficienza e tolleranza al rumore lo rendono una scelta preziosa per varie applicazioni ed \u00e8 probabile che rimanga rilevante con il progresso della tecnologia.<\/p>","protected":false},"featured_media":475703,"menu_order":0,"template":"","meta":{"_acf_changed":false,"content-type":"","inline_featured_image":false,"footnotes":""},"class_list":["post-475927","wiki","type-wiki","status-publish","has-post-thumbnail","hentry"],"acf":{"faq_title":"Frequently Asked Questions about <mark>Asynchronous Transmission: A Comprehensive Guide<\/mark>","faq_items":[{"question":"What is asynchronous transmission?","answer":"<p>Asynchronous transmission is a communication method used in computer networks and telecommunications. It allows data transmission between devices without requiring synchronized clocks, making it flexible and efficient for various applications.<\/p>"},{"question":"How did asynchronous transmission originate?","answer":"<p>The concept of asynchronous transmission dates back to the early days of telegraphy in the mid-19th century. The first electrical telegraph systems used Morse code, and the transmission was inherently asynchronous, as operators manually input signals.<\/p>"},{"question":"How does asynchronous transmission work?","answer":"<p>Asynchronous transmission involves sending data in frames with start and stop bits. Each frame contains a start bit to indicate the beginning, data bits, an optional parity bit for error checking, and one or more stop bits to indicate the end. Devices can communicate independently without relying on strict timing.<\/p>"},{"question":"What are the key features of asynchronous transmission?","answer":"<p>Asynchronous transmission offers flexibility, error detection using parity bit, efficiency with low overhead, and noise tolerance. It allows devices to operate at different speeds and handle noisy communication channels effectively.<\/p>"},{"question":"What types of asynchronous transmission exist?","answer":"<p>Asynchronous transmission can be categorized into two types:<\/p><ol><li>1 Stop Bit: The most common type, with a single stop bit following the data bits.<\/li><li>2 Stop Bits: Less common, with two stop bits following the data bits.<\/li><\/ol>"},{"question":"In what ways is asynchronous transmission used?","answer":"<p>Asynchronous transmission finds applications in various areas, such as serial communication between computers and peripheral devices, modem communication, and IoT devices for data transfer and power conservation.<\/p>"},{"question":"What challenges does asynchronous transmission face?","answer":"<p>Despite its advantages, asynchronous transmission may have limited data rate capabilities for high-speed data transfer. It can also encounter synchronization issues when devices operate at significantly different speeds.<\/p>"},{"question":"How does asynchronous transmission compare to synchronous transmission?","answer":"<p>Asynchronous transmission does not require synchronized clocks and has lower overhead due to start-stop bits. In contrast, synchronous transmission relies on synchronized clocks and has higher overhead due to constant timing.<\/p>"},{"question":"What are the future perspectives and technologies related to asynchronous transmission?","answer":"<p>Asynchronous transmission is expected to continue playing a significant role in communication systems. Future advancements may include improved error detection and correction techniques, enhancing its reliability and efficiency.<\/p>"},{"question":"How are proxy servers associated with asynchronous transmission?","answer":"<p>While not directly tied to asynchronous transmission, proxy servers act as intermediaries in communication and can optimize data exchange, handle caching, and provide an additional layer of security for communication processes.<\/p>"}]},"_links":{"self":[{"href":"https:\/\/oneproxy.pro\/it\/wp-json\/wp\/v2\/wiki\/475927","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/oneproxy.pro\/it\/wp-json\/wp\/v2\/wiki"}],"about":[{"href":"https:\/\/oneproxy.pro\/it\/wp-json\/wp\/v2\/types\/wiki"}],"version-history":[{"count":0,"href":"https:\/\/oneproxy.pro\/it\/wp-json\/wp\/v2\/wiki\/475927\/revisions"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/oneproxy.pro\/it\/wp-json\/wp\/v2\/media\/475703"}],"wp:attachment":[{"href":"https:\/\/oneproxy.pro\/it\/wp-json\/wp\/v2\/media?parent=475927"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}